Summer EBT Card 2026
Summer EBT may be loaded to an existing EBT card or sent on a new card. The card type is decided by the state using the records it has for your household.
If you already have SNAP or another EBT benefit
Many states try to load Summer EBT onto the existing EBT card when the child can be matched to the household's case. Check that card balance before waiting for a new card.
If your state says it will mail a separate card, keep watching the mailing address on your case or application.
If you receive a new Summer EBT card
A new card may arrive before or after the benefit is loaded. Follow the activation instructions that come with the card and use your state agency source for balance and replacement-card help.
Before requesting a replacement card
- Check the official issue window for your state.
- Look at any notice from the state agency.
- Check the balance on any existing EBT card tied to your household.
- Confirm the mailing address used for the child or benefit case.

Will Summer EBT go on my SNAP card?
It may, if your state can match the child to your SNAP or EBT case. Some households still receive a separate card.
What should I do if the card has no balance?
Check the official issue window, wait for the posted load date if it has not passed, and then use the state card support route.
Is SUN Bucks the same as Summer EBT?
SUN Bucks is the name many agencies use for Summer EBT.
